Romania said an unauthorized drone that entered its airspace was shot down by NATO's Spanish F-18 fighter jets. Defense Minister Radu-Dinel Miruta said in a social media post that the drone was detected near Galati in the country's southeast, and two F-18 jets were scrambled as part of NATO's air policing mission. The Spanish F-18s intercepted the drone, which crashed into an uninhabited forested area.
Miruta said an investigation has been launched to determine the drone's country of origin, and thanked the Spanish pilots and the Romanian military for their successful mission. In July, three drones that entered Romanian airspace on three consecutive days were also shot down.
